    Muscle Car Of The Week Video Episode #134: 1966 Shelby GT350H
    #musclecar #v8tv
    www.musclecarof... - How cool would it be to buzz down to your local Hertz rental car office and pick up a 1966 Shelby GT350H for just $17.00 per day and $.17 a mile? This time, we take a look at a very rare Candy Apple Red '66 Shelby GT350H rental racer.

    This car was converted to 4 speed. All 85 manual 66 gt350h were raven black, rest of cars were C4 automatic. Sidenote: 1966 gt350 with 4 speed had 3.89 rear axle ratio, automatics had 3.50 rear. Limited slip was an option, all Hertz cars came with open diff. One way they dealt with aggressive brakes - put warning sticker on dash.

    Well, it didn't take them 40 years - there were 224 1968 gt350 made for Hertz. Couple things incorrect with the car in video: all 1966 rent-a-racer' had 14" Magnum 500 wheels and exhaust ending with turndowns before rear bumper, not before rear axle.
